/*
* Vampy : This plugin is a wrapper around the Vamp plugin API.
* It allows for writing Vamp plugins in Python.
* Centre for Digital Music, Queen Mary University of London.
* Copyright (C) 2008-2009 Gyorgy Fazekas, QMUL. (See Vamp sources
* for licence information.)
*/
#include <Python.h>
#include "PyRealTime.h"
#include "vamp-sdk/Plugin.h"
#include <string>
using namespace std;
using namespace Vamp;
using Vamp::Plugin;
using Vamp::RealTime;
/* CONSTRUCTOR: New RealTime object from sec and nsec */
static PyObject*
RealTime_new(PyTypeObject *type, PyObject *args, PyObject *kw)
{
unsigned int sec = 0;
unsigned int nsec = 0;
double unary = 0;
const char *fmt = NULL;
if (
/// new RealTime from ('format',float) e.g. ('seconds',2.34123)
!PyArg_ParseTuple(args, "|sd:RealTime.new ",
(const char *) &fmt,
(double *) &unary) &&
/// new RealTime from (sec{int},nsec{int}) e.g. (2,34)
!PyArg_ParseTuple(args, "|II:RealTime.new ",
(unsigned int*) &sec,
(unsigned int*) &nsec)
) {
PyErr_SetString(PyExc_TypeError,
"RealTime initialised with wrong arguments.");
return NULL;
}
// PyErr_Clear();
// RealTimeObject *self = PyObject_New(RealTimeObject, &RealTime_Type);
RealTimeObject *self = (RealTimeObject*)type->tp_alloc(type, 0);
if (self == NULL) return NULL;
self->rt = NULL;
if (sec == 0 && nsec == 0 && fmt == 0)
self->rt = new RealTime();
else if (fmt == 0)
self->rt = new RealTime(sec,nsec);
else {
/// new RealTime from seconds or milliseconds: i.e. >>>RealTime('seconds',12.3)
if (!string(fmt).compare("float") ||
!string(fmt).compare("seconds"))
self->rt = new RealTime(
RealTime::fromSeconds((double) unary));
if (!string(fmt).compare("milliseconds")) {
self->rt = new RealTime(
RealTime::fromSeconds((double) unary / 1000.0)); }
}
if (!self->rt) {
PyErr_SetString(PyExc_TypeError,
"RealTime initialised with wrong arguments.");
return NULL;
}
return (PyObject *) self;
}
/* DESTRUCTOR: delete type object */
static void
RealTimeObject_dealloc(RealTimeObject *self)
{
if (self->rt) delete self->rt; //delete the C object
PyObject_Del(self); //delete the Python object (original)
/// this requires PyType_Ready() which fills ob_type
// self->ob_type->tp_free((PyObject*)self);
}
/* RealTime Object's Methods */
//these are internals not exposed by the module but the object
/* Returns a Tuple containing sec and nsec values */
static PyObject *
RealTime_values(RealTimeObject *self)
{
return Py_BuildValue("(ii)",self->rt->sec,self->rt->nsec);
}
/* Returns a Text representation */
static PyObject *
RealTime_toString(RealTimeObject *self, PyObject *args)
{
return Py_BuildValue("s",self->rt->toText().c_str());
}
/* Frame representation */
static PyObject *
RealTime_toFrame(PyObject *self, PyObject *args)
{
unsigned int samplerate;
if ( !PyArg_ParseTuple(args, "I:realtime.toFrame object ",
(unsigned int *) &samplerate )) {
PyErr_SetString(PyExc_ValueError,"Integer Sample Rate Required.");
return NULL;
}
return Py_BuildValue("k",
RealTime::realTime2Frame(
*(const RealTime*) ((RealTimeObject*)self)->rt,
(unsigned int) samplerate));
}
/* Conversion of realtime to a double precision floating point value */
/* ...in Python called by e.g. float(realtime) */
static PyObject *
RealTime_float(PyObject *s)
{
double drt = ((double) ((RealTimeObject*)s)->rt->sec +
(double)((double) ((RealTimeObject*)s)->rt->nsec)/1000000000);
return PyFloat_FromDouble(drt);
}
/* Type object's (RealTime) methods table */
static PyMethodDef RealTime_methods[] =
{
{"values", (PyCFunction)RealTime_values, METH_NOARGS,
PyDoc_STR("values() -> Tuple of sec,nsec representation.")},
{"toString", (PyCFunction)RealTime_toString, METH_NOARGS,
PyDoc_STR("toString() -> Return a user-readable string to the nearest millisecond in a form like HH:MM:SS.mmm")},
{"toFrame", (PyCFunction)RealTime_toFrame, METH_VARARGS,
PyDoc_STR("toFrame(samplerate) -> Sample count for given sample rate.")},
{"toFloat", (PyCFunction)RealTime_float, METH_NOARGS,
PyDoc_STR("toFloat() -> Floating point representation.")},
{NULL, NULL} /* sentinel */
};
/* Methods implementing protocols */
// these functions are called by the interpreter
/* Object Protocol */
static int
RealTime_setattr(RealTimeObject *self, char *name, PyObject *value)
{
if ( !string(name).compare("sec")) {
self->rt->sec= (int) PyInt_AS_LONG(value);
return 0;
}
if ( !string(name).compare("nsec")) {
self->rt->nsec= (int) PyInt_AS_LONG(value);
return 0;
}
return -1;
}
static PyObject *
RealTime_getattr(RealTimeObject *self, char *name)
{
if ( !string(name).compare("sec") ) {
return PyInt_FromSsize_t(
(Py_ssize_t) self->rt->sec);
}
if ( !string(name).compare("nsec") ) {
return PyInt_FromSsize_t(
(Py_ssize_t) self->rt->nsec);
}
return Py_FindMethod(RealTime_methods,
(PyObject *)self, name);
}
/* String representation called by e.g. str(realtime), print realtime*/
static PyObject *
RealTime_repr(PyObject *self)
{
return Py_BuildValue("s",
((RealTimeObject*)self)->rt->toString().c_str());
}
/* Number Protocol */
/// TODO: implement all methods available in Vamp::RealTime() objects
static PyObject *
RealTime_add(PyObject *s, PyObject *w)
{
RealTimeObject *result =
PyObject_New(RealTimeObject, &RealTime_Type);
if (result == NULL) return NULL;
result->rt = new RealTime(
*((RealTimeObject*)s)->rt + *((RealTimeObject*)w)->rt);
return (PyObject*)result;
}
static PyObject *
RealTime_subtract(PyObject *s, PyObject *w)
{
RealTimeObject *result =
PyObject_New(RealTimeObject, &RealTime_Type);
if (result == NULL) return NULL;
result->rt = new RealTime(
*((RealTimeObject*)s)->rt - *((RealTimeObject*)w)->rt);
return (PyObject*)result;
}
static PyNumberMethods realtime_as_number =
{
RealTime_add, /*nb_add*/
RealTime_subtract, /*nb_subtract*/
0, /*nb_multiply*/
0, /*nb_divide*/
0, /*nb_remainder*/
0, /*nb_divmod*/
0, /*nb_power*/
0, /*nb_neg*/
0, /*nb_pos*/
0, /*(unaryfunc)array_abs,*/
0, /*nb_nonzero*/
0, /*nb_invert*/
0, /*nb_lshift*/
0, /*nb_rshift*/
0, /*nb_and*/
0, /*nb_xor*/
0, /*nb_or*/
0, /*nb_coerce*/
0, /*nb_int*/
0, /*nb_long*/
(unaryfunc)RealTime_float,/*nb_float*/
0, /*nb_oct*/
0, /*nb_hex*/
};
/* REAL-TIME TYPE OBJECT */
#define RealTime_alloc PyType_GenericAlloc
#define RealTime_free PyObject_Del
/* Doc:: 10.3 Type Objects */ /* static */
PyTypeObject RealTime_Type =
{
PyObject_HEAD_INIT(NULL)
0, /*ob_size*/
"vampy.RealTime", /*tp_name*/
sizeof(RealTimeObject), /*tp_basicsize*/
0,//sizeof(RealTime), /*tp_itemsize*/
/* methods */
(destructor)RealTimeObject_dealloc, /*tp_dealloc*/
0, /*tp_print*/
(getattrfunc)RealTime_getattr, /*tp_getattr*/
(setattrfunc)RealTime_setattr, /*tp_setattr*/
0, /*tp_compare*/
RealTime_repr, /*tp_repr*/
&realtime_as_number, /*tp_as_number*/
0, /*tp_as_sequence*/
0, /*tp_as_mapping*/
0, /*tp_hash*/
0,//(ternaryfunc)RealTime_new, /*tp_call*/
0, /*tp_str*/
0, /*tp_getattro*/
0, /*tp_setattro*/
0, /*tp_as_buffer*/
Py_TPFLAGS_DEFAULT, /*tp_flags*/
"RealTime Object", /*tp_doc*/
0, /*tp_traverse*/
0, /*tp_clear*/
0, /*tp_richcompare*/
0, /*tp_weaklistoffset*/
0, /*tp_iter*/
0, /*tp_iternext*/
RealTime_methods, /*tp_methods*/ //TypeObject Methods
0, /*tp_members*/
0, /*tp_getset*/
0, /*tp_base*/
0, /*tp_dict*/
0, /*tp_descr_get*/
0, /*tp_descr_set*/
0, /*tp_dictoffset*/
0, /*tp_init*/
RealTime_alloc, /*tp_alloc*/
RealTime_new, /*tp_new*/
RealTime_free, /*tp_free*/
0, /*tp_is_gc*/
};
/* PyRealTime C++ API */
/*PyRealTime from RealTime pointer
PyObject*
PyRealTime_FromRealTime(Vamp::RealTime *rt) {
RealTimeObject *self =
PyObject_New(RealTimeObject, &RealTime_Type);
if (self == NULL) return NULL;
self->rt = new RealTime(*rt);
return (PyObject*) self;
}*/
/*PyRealTime from RealTime*/
PyObject*
PyRealTime_FromRealTime(Vamp::RealTime& rt) {
RealTimeObject *self =
PyObject_New(RealTimeObject, &RealTime_Type);
if (self == NULL) return NULL;
self->rt = new RealTime(rt);
return (PyObject*) self;
}
/*RealTime* from PyRealTime*/
const Vamp::RealTime*
PyRealTime_AsRealTime (PyObject *self) {
RealTimeObject *s = (RealTimeObject*) self;
if (!PyRealTime_Check(s)) {
PyErr_SetString(PyExc_TypeError, "RealTime Object Expected.");
cerr << "in call PyRealTime_AsPointer(): RealTime Object Expected. " << endl;
return NULL; }
return s->rt;
};
